India’s office space market is undergoing a noticeable transformation as businesses increasingly favour flexible workplace solutions over conventional office leasing. Recent research based on workspace enquiries, long term search patterns, and geographic insights shows that adaptable office formats now account for a substantial share of workplace demand across the country. According to the study, flexible workspace options represent 73% of office related search activity, while traditional office leasing contributes less than 27% of overall demand indicators.
The findings suggest that organisations are placing greater emphasis on flexibility, scalability, and operational convenience when evaluating workplace requirements. The analysis draws on 387,000 verified workspace enquiries collected across 30 countries and combines this information with nine years of search trend data. The results indicate that office demand is no longer concentrated solely in major business centres, with increasing interest emerging from smaller cities and overseas markets connected to India.
Workplace searches are becoming increasingly specific as organisations look for solutions tailored to particular operational needs. Rather than searching broadly for office space, users are focusing on individual workspace categories that support flexible working models. Meeting room related demand has increased by 187% during the past three years, making it one of the fastest growing workspace segments.
Virtual office searches have also recorded significant growth of 99%, reflecting continued interest in business presence solutions without the need for permanent office occupancy. Demand for day pass access has risen by 20% over the same period. Together, these specialised workspace categories account for nearly 90% of coworking related search activity. This pattern highlights the growing preference for short term and adaptable workplace arrangements that can support changing business requirements.
Managed office solutions are attracting increasing attention across India. Search activity for this segment has expanded by 778% since 2022, demonstrating rising awareness among office users. Despite this rapid growth, managed office demand remains considerably lower than coworking related searches, suggesting further scope for market development. Sustainability is also playing a larger role in workplace selection decisions. Green certified office parks account for more than two thirds of office park related search volume nationwide. Seven of the ten most searched office parks hold recognised environmental certifications. One certified technology park generates approximately 122,000 monthly searches, illustrating the growing influence of sustainable infrastructure on corporate location decisions and workplace planning.
The research also highlights growing international engagement in India’s office market. Approximately 3% of office related searches originate outside the country. The largest share comes from the United States, followed by the United Kingdom and the United Arab Emirates. Workplace decision making is becoming more inclusive as well. Women now account for 24.2% of workspace enquiries, with strong participation levels recorded in Bengaluru, Mumbai, and Hyderabad. These trends reflect a broader range of stakeholders influencing office selection as India’s workplace landscape continues to evolve.
1. What are flexible workspaces?
Flexible workspaces are office solutions that offer adaptable usage options, including coworking areas, meeting rooms, virtual offices, and day pass facilities, allowing businesses to scale according to their needs.
2. What are targeted workspace solutions?
Targeted workspace solutions are specialised office offerings designed for specific business requirements, such as meeting rooms for collaboration, virtual offices for business registration, and short-term workspace access for hybrid teams.
3. Why are businesses increasingly choosing flexible office spaces?
Businesses are selecting flexible office spaces because they provide greater operational adaptability, access to specialised facilities, and workspace options that can align with changing workforce and business requirements.
4. What percentage of office space searches are for flexible workspaces?
Flexible workspace formats account for 73% of office related search activity across India.
5. How important is sustainability in office selection?
Green certified office parks generate more than two thirds of office park search interest, showing strong demand for sustainable workplaces.
